Fast Start Not Enough at Lycoming

WILLIAMSPORT, Pa. - Hood College and Lycoming traded first half runs, but it was the Warriors who were able to carry momentum into the second half for a 62-55 win in Middle Atlantic Conference Commonwealth play.

Jared Ruiz (Frederick, Md. / Oakdale) knocked down 5-of-7 3-point field goals on his way to 17 points. Davon Hill (Clinton, Md. / Potomac School) added 13 points and four assists. Daniel Wegener (Falling Waters, W.Va. / Broadfording Christian) grabbed seven rebounds and blocked two shots. 

In addition to Ruiz's big day from 3, Hill went 2-of-3 as the Blazers hit 12-of-27 3-pointers as a team (44 percent).

The Blazers opened the game with a 20-4 run, at one point holding Lycoming scoreless for over 10 minutes. Calvin Chandler ended the drought with a 3 with eight minutes and 25 seconds left in the half to make it 20-7 in favor of Hood. The shot started a run for the Warriors, who outscored the Blazers 22-4 over the remainder of the first half. A 3-pointer by David Johnson in the closing seconds gave Lycoming a 26-25 edge at halftime. 

Once play resumed, neither team scored for over three minutes. A Wegener lay up started the second half scoring and made it 27-26 in favor of the Blazers with 16:36 to play. It was the first of eight leads changes or ties in the second half. Hood took a 36-34 lead on Michael Robinson's (Upper Marlboro, Md. / Pallotti) 3-pointer with 9:40 on the game clock, but Willie Kee went to the free throw line in each of the Warriors' next two possessions. The guard knocked down all four free throws to give Lycoming the lead for good, 38-36, with 9:22 to play.

Kee had a game-high 19 points on 5-of-9 shooting and was a perfect 7-of-7 mark at the free throw line. David Johnson was 6-of-6 at the line on his way to 14 points. Lycoming went 20-of-24 at the free throw line as a team (83 percent).

Hood outrebounded the Warriors 32-29, but were undone by 28 turnovers. 

The loss dropped the Blazers to 12-11 overall and 6-8 in the MAC Commonwealth. The latter places Hood one game behind Widener and Stevenson, who are tied for the fifth and final conference tournament spot with two games to play.

The Blazers host Stevenson on Tuesday, Feb. 16 at 8 p.m.
